位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

excel乘法为什么都是0

作者:excel百科网
|
165人看过
发布时间:2026-01-04 03:20:38
标签:
Excel 中乘法为什么都是 0?真相揭秘在 Excel 这个强大的电子表格工具中,乘法操作看似简单,但背后却隐藏着许多让人意想不到的规则与逻辑。特别是“Excel 中乘法为什么都是 0”这一问题,常常引发用户的困惑与好奇。本文将从
excel乘法为什么都是0
Excel 中乘法为什么都是 0?真相揭秘
在 Excel 这个强大的电子表格工具中,乘法操作看似简单,但背后却隐藏着许多让人意想不到的规则与逻辑。特别是“Excel 中乘法为什么都是 0”这一问题,常常引发用户的困惑与好奇。本文将从 Excel 的基本原理、乘法运算的底层逻辑、Excel 的数据结构、公式与函数的使用、以及实际应用场景等多方面进行深入分析,揭示 Excel 中乘法为何会出现 0 的现象,并探讨其背后的深层原因。
一、Excel 的基本原理与乘法运算
Excel 是一种基于表格的电子计算工具,其核心是通过单元格的数值运算来实现数据的处理与分析。在 Excel 中,乘法是一种基本的算术运算,它遵循数学中的乘法法则:`a × b = c`,其中 `c` 是 `a` 和 `b` 的乘积。
Excel 中的乘法运算通常通过 `=A1B1` 的公式实现,当两个单元格中的数值相乘时,结果会以数值形式显示。然而,对于某些特定情况,乘法结果却会是 0,这并非是因为数值本身为 0,而是因为在 Excel 的数据结构中存在某些特殊规则。
二、Excel 中乘法为何会出现 0:数据结构与计算规则
在 Excel 中,单元格的数据类型可以是数字、文本、日期、逻辑值(如 TRUE/FALSE)等。当进行乘法运算时,Excel 会根据单元格的数据类型进行自动转换,以确保运算的正确性。
1. 数字与 0 的关系
如果两个单元格中的数值都为 0,那么它们的乘积自然也是 0。例如,`=A1B1`,其中 `A1` 和 `B1` 都是 0,结果为 0。
2. 文本与乘法的转换规则
如果单元格中存储的是文本而非数字,Excel 会尝试将文本转换为数值以进行运算。例如,如果 `A1` 是“0”,`B1` 是“0”,那么 `=A1B1` 的结果是 0。但如果 `A1` 是“00”,`B1` 是“0”,那么 Excel 会将其视为 0,结果为 0。
3. 逻辑值的处理
Excel 中的逻辑值(TRUE/FALSE)在乘法运算中会被视为 1 和 0。例如,`=TRUEFALSE` 的结果是 0,因为 TRUE 为 1,FALSE 为 0,相乘为 0。
4. 日期与乘法的转换
Excel 中的日期是以天数为单位存储的,例如 2023-01-01 被存储为 44557。当进行乘法运算时,Excel 会将日期转换为数值进行计算。如果两个日期相乘,结果可能为 0,例如,`=DATE(2023,1,1)DATE(2023,1,1)` 的结果为 0,因为两个日期相乘后得到的数值为 0。
三、Excel 中乘法为何会出现 0:公式与函数的使用
Excel 中的乘法运算不仅仅依赖于单元格的数值,还依赖于公式与函数的使用。不同的函数在不同的情况下会产生不同的结果,导致乘法运算中出现 0。
1. SUMPRODUCT 函数
`SUMPRODUCT` 函数可以将多个数组中的元素相乘后求和。例如,`=SUMPRODUCT(A1:A5, B1:B5)` 会将 A1 到 A5 和 B1 到 B5 的元素相乘,求和结果。如果其中任何一个数组中的元素为 0,结果就会是 0。
2. IF 函数与乘法的结合
`IF` 函数可以用于判断条件,而当条件满足时,执行乘法运算。例如,`=IF(A1>0, A1B1, 0)`,如果 A1 是正数,结果为 A1B1;否则为 0。这可以帮助用户在特定条件下控制乘法的结果。
3. 数组公式与乘法的结合
在 Excel 中,数组公式的使用可以实现更复杂的运算。例如,`=SUMPRODUCT((A1:A5>0)(B1:B5>0))` 可以统计 A1 到 A5 和 B1 到 B5 中大于 0 的元素数量。当其中任何一个数组中没有元素大于 0 时,结果为 0。
四、Excel 中乘法为何会出现 0:实际应用场景
在实际工作中,Excel 的乘法运算常常用于统计、计算、数据处理等场景。在这些场景中,乘法结果为 0 的情况可能出现在不同的位置,需要用户根据具体情况进行处理。
1. 统计与分析
在统计分析中,Excel 用于计算数据的均值、标准差、方差等。例如,`=AVERAGE(A1:A10)` 可以计算 A1 到 A10 的平均值。如果其中有任何一个单元格为 0,结果可能会受到影响。
2. 数据验证与条件判断
在数据验证中,Excel 用于确保某些条件满足。例如,`=IF(A1>0, B1, 0)` 可以在 A1 为正数时显示 B1 的值,否则显示 0。这种逻辑可以帮助用户在特定条件下控制数据的显示。
3. 财务计算
在财务计算中,Excel 用于计算利息、利润、成本等。例如,`=A1B1` 可以用于计算某项投资的收益。如果 A1 或 B1 为 0,结果为 0。
五、Excel 中乘法为何会出现 0:用户常见误解
在实际使用中,用户可能会误以为乘法结果为 0 的原因与数值本身有关,但实际上,Excel 中的乘法结果 0 是由数据结构、函数使用、逻辑判断等多种因素共同作用的结果。
1. 数值为 0 的误解
用户可能认为,如果两个单元格中的数值为 0,它们的乘积必然为 0。这是正确的,但并不是唯一的原因。
2. 文本与逻辑值的处理
用户可能误以为文本或逻辑值不能参与乘法运算,但实际上,Excel 会将文本转换为数值以进行运算。
3. 日期与时间的处理
用户可能误以为日期不能参与乘法运算,但实际上,Excel 会将日期转换为数值进行计算。
六、Excel 中乘法为何会出现 0:总结与建议
Excel 中的乘法运算结果为 0,是多种因素共同作用的结果,包括单元格的数据类型、函数使用、逻辑判断等。用户在使用 Excel 进行计算时,应充分了解数据结构和运算规则,避免因误解而导致错误。
在实际应用中,建议用户在进行乘法运算时,注意数据的类型和逻辑条件,确保计算结果的准确性。同时,可以使用函数和公式来优化计算,提高效率和准确性。
七、Excel 中乘法为何会出现 0:
Excel 是一个功能强大的电子表格工具,其乘法运算的规则和逻辑,看似简单,实则复杂。在实际使用中,用户需要具备一定的计算能力和逻辑判断能力,以确保计算结果的正确性。对于“Excel 中乘法为什么都是 0”这一问题,答案不仅在于数值本身,更在于数据结构、函数使用和逻辑判断的综合影响。只有理解这些规则,用户才能更好地利用 Excel 进行数据处理和分析。
推荐文章
相关文章
推荐URL
为什么Excel表下拉序号?——深度解析其功能与使用技巧在Excel中,下拉序号是一项非常实用的功能,它能帮助用户快速生成连续的数字序列,提升数据处理的效率。无论是用于表格编号、库存管理,还是统计分析,下拉序号都能提供高效的解决方案。
2026-01-04 03:20:35
237人看过
为什么Excel求和显示灰色?深度解析与实用技巧在Excel中,当我们使用 SUM 函数进行求和时,如果结果显示为灰色,这通常意味着某些条件未被满足,或者数据格式与预期不符。本文将从多个角度深入解析“为什么Excel求和显示灰色”的原
2026-01-04 03:20:34
275人看过
Excel 空格符是什么?——深度解析其功能与使用技巧在 Excel 中,空格符是一个看似简单的字符,却在数据处理、公式编写和表格编辑中发挥着重要作用。它不仅仅是一个“空白”字符,而是具有特定功能的符号,它的存在往往会影响数据的准确性
2026-01-04 03:11:58
187人看过
在Excel中,数字的表示方式是其基础功能之一,而其中“E”符号的使用则是一个非常重要的知识点,它不仅用于科学计数法,还广泛应用于数据处理和计算中。本文将深入探讨“E”在Excel中的含义、使用场景、与其他数字格式的区别,以及其在实际工作中
2026-01-04 03:11:34
329人看过
热门推荐
热门专题:
资讯中心: